Bookkeeping

Day-to-day financial record keeping for businesses and sole traders. We organise income and expense records and maintain accurate books that reflect what's actually happening in your business.

  • Recording income and expenses
  • Categorising transactions
  • Maintaining accurate, current ledgers
  • Ongoing or one-off engagements
02

Bank reconciliation

Matching bank transactions with the invoices, receipts and records that should sit behind them — so the numbers in your accounts match the numbers in your bank.

  • Reconciling bank statements with bookkeeping records
  • Identifying and flagging discrepancies
  • Keeping reconciliations current month-on-month
03

Invoice & receipt organisation

Recording sales invoices and organising purchase invoices and receipts. The bedrock work that lets everything else — VAT, accounts, tax — be done properly later.

  • Recording sales invoices issued
  • Filing and categorising purchase invoices and receipts
  • Maintaining a clean audit trail of supporting documents
04

Year-end bookkeeping prep

Before your accountant prepares your year-end accounts, the underlying bookkeeping needs to be complete, reconciled and tidy. We do that preparation, so your accountant's work is faster and your records are coherent.

  • Organising records for the financial year
  • Completing outstanding reconciliations
  • Preparing a clean handover for your accountant or tax adviser
05

VAT bookkeeping support

Preparing bookkeeping records for VAT returns and organising VAT-related income and expense records.

  • Recording VAT on sales and purchases
  • Organising records ahead of VAT return periods
  • Producing tidy VAT-ready bookkeeping for review
Note — we prepare VAT-ready bookkeeping records. Filing the VAT return itself is handled by you or your accountant.
06

Payroll support

Payroll record support and employee payment administration, kept aligned with the rest of your bookkeeping.

  • Maintaining payroll records
  • Supporting employee payment administration
  • Keeping payroll figures reconciled with bookkeeping
07

Self-employed bookkeeping

Bookkeeping for sole traders, contractors and freelancers — the kind of clean, simple record-keeping that makes Self Assessment season much less painful when it arrives.

  • Income and expense tracking
  • Mileage, expenses and allowable-cost record keeping
  • Records prepared for review by your accountant or for Self Assessment
08

Small business finance admin

Keeping invoices, receipts and records organised — helping business owners understand and act on their financial paperwork rather than letting it pile up.

  • Sorting and filing financial paperwork
  • Setting up simple, sustainable records routines
  • Making sense of where the numbers actually come from
